Ireland's Carolyn Hibberd finished 1-8 in the 0-team qualifying round. . In their opening game, Ireland's Carolyn Hibberd lost 11-3 to Finland's Oona Kauste, droppimg another game, 14-3 to England's Fiona Hawker. Ireland's Carolyn Hibberd lost 11-9 to Estonia's Kristiine Lill. Ireland's Carolyn Hibberd lost 8-4 to Hungary's Ildiko Szekeres where Ireland's Carolyn Hibberd responded with a 12-8 win over Wales's Laura Beever. Ireland's Carolyn Hibberd went on to lose 10-6 against Poland's Elzbieta Ran. Ireland's Carolyn Hibberd lost 6-4 to Slovakia's Gabriela Kajanova. Ireland's Carolyn Hibberd lost 10-3 to Austria's Karina Toth. Ireland's Carolyn Hibberd lost 11-5 to Spain's Oihane Otaegi in their final qualifying round match.
